Gauges and Driver Information Interface

Gauges include the speedometer, tachometer, fuel gauge, and related indicators.

They are displayed when the ignition switch is in ON w*1.

Displays your driving speed in mph or km/h.

Shows the number of engine revolutions per minute.

Displays the amount of fuel left in the fuel tank.

    Temperature Gauge

Displays the temperature of the engine coolant.

*1: Models with the smart entry system have an ENGINE START/STOP button instead of an ignition switch.

    Odometer

Shows the total number of miles or kilometers that your vehicle has accumulated.

    Trip Meter

Shows the total number of miles or kilometers driven since the last reset. Meters A and B can be used to measure two separate trips.

    Resetting a trip meter

To reset a trip meter, display it, then press and hold the knob. The trip meter is reset to 0.0.

uuGauges and Driver Information Interface uDriver Information Interface

    Average Fuel Economy Shows the estimated average fuel economy of each trip meter in mpg or l/100 km. The display is updated at set intervals. When a trip meter is reset, the average fuel

economy is also reset.

    Range Shows the estimated distance you can travel on the remaining fuel. This estimated distance is based on the vehicle’s current fuel economy.

Shows the time elapsed since Trip A or Trip B was reset.

Shows the average speed in mph or km/h since Trip A or Trip B was reset.

    Engine Oil Life

Shows the remaining oil life and Maintenance MinderTM.

    Outside Temperature

Shows the outside temperature in Fahrenheit (U.S.) or Celsius (Canada).

    Adjusting the outside temperature display

Adjust the temperature reading by up to ±5°F or ±3°C if the temperature reading seems incorrect.

Use the customized features in the driver information interface or audio/information screen to correct the temperature.

Measures the lap time, and displays the previously measured times, split time and the fastest lap time.

    Measuring LAP Time
    Press the ENTER button to display the lap time measurement screen.
    Press the ENTER button to start measurement.
    Press the ENTER button again to stop measurement.

u To measure the time per lap, press the 3 / 4 button at the completion of each lap.

u To return to the Stopwatch screen, press the (Hang-up/back) button.

* Not available on all models

uuGauges and Driver Information Interface uDriver Information Interface

    Checking/Clearing history
    To check history, press the button (when lap time is not running) to change the display, then press the 3 / 4 button to scroll through lap times.

u A maximum of 20 lap times can be stored at a time.

    To clear the history, press and hold the 3 / button when lap time is not running.
    To return to the lap time measurement screen, press the button.
    To return to the Stopwatch screen, press the (Hang-up/back) button.

    Example of customization settings

Below are steps that explain how to change the reset timing for trip A from the default setting (manual) so that it resets automatically when the vehicle is fully refueled.

    Press the button to select Vehicle

Settings, then press the ENTER button.

    Press the 3 / 4 button until Meter Setup

appears on the display.

    Press the ENTER button.

u Language Selection appears first in the display.

Continued

uuGauges and Driver Information InterfaceuDriver Information Interface

    Press the 3 / 4 button until “Trip A” Reset Timing appears on the display, then press the ENTER button.

u The display switches to the customization setup screen, where you can select When Refueled, IGN OFF, Manually Reset, or Exit.

    Press the 3 / 4 button and select When Refueled, then press the ENTER button. u The When Refueled Setup screen

appears, then the display returns to the customization menu screen.

    Press the 3 / 4 button until Exit appears on the display, then press the ENTER button.
    Repeat Step 6 until you return to the normal screen.
